DNR Announces PLANT Award Recipients for 2006
ANNAPOLIS— The Maryland Urban and Community Forest Committee (MUCFC) and the Department of Natural Resources have announced the statewide Maryland Community PLANT (People Loving And Nurturing Trees) Award recipients for 2006.

The PLANT award is given to communities for their commitment to planting and caring for trees, and increasing the public's understanding and appreciation of the role of trees in helping create healthy, sustainable communities and a cleaner Chesapeake Bay.

Schools, homeowner's associations, parks, cities, towns and other entities throughout Maryland will be presented their Awards next month at official Arbor Day and Earth Day ceremonies. Of the 127 PLANT Award winners this year, 47 Awardees have reached the top GREEN Level.

"We encourage each community to increase their efforts each year and grow to the next award level if possible. We're thrilled that so many PLANT Award communities are committed to sustaining their efforts year after year at the level where they're most capable," said Steve Parker, Chairman of the Urban Committee.

The Maryland Department of Natural Resources (DNR) is the state agency responsible for providing natural and living resource-related services to citizens and visitors. DNR manages more than 446,000 acres of public lands and 18,000 miles of waterways, along with Maryland's forests, fisheries and wildlife for maximum environmental, economic and quality of life benefits. A national leader in land conservation, DNR-managed parks and natural, historic and cultural resources attract 11 million visitors annually.
